The super - strong folding polystyrene frames can bear up to 350 lbs of static weight, guaranteeing long - lasting durability and stability anywhere. Key features include a set of two folding poly resin Adirondack chairs with gray padded cushions, extra - wide backs and arms for a cozy seating experience, ultra - tough folding polystyrene frames, resistance to rot, peeling, and chipping with no need for sanding or painting, all - weather fabric cushions with zippered removable covers for effortless maintenance, 2 - inch thick back and seat padding for enhanced comfort, rear elastic straps to keep cushions in place, quick and simple assembly, easy cleaning with water and neutral detergent, and cushion covers that can be wiped clean with a damp cloth or hand - washed for a deep clean.













Using these chairs is a breeze. Just unfold them and place them where you want to relax, whether it's on your deck, porch, or inside your home. Make sure to attach the cushions using the rear elastic straps so they stay in place. When it comes to weight, don't exceed 350 lbs on each chair to keep them stable and durable. For maintenance, clean the frames with water and a bit of neutral detergent regularly. If the cushions get dirty, you can unzip the covers and either wipe them clean with a damp cloth for light stains or hand - wash them for a more thorough clean. Store the chairs in a dry place during extreme weather conditions to prevent any damage. And remember, no sanding or painting is required as the chairs are resistant to rot, peeling, and chipping.
